Changed a temp XPCOM manual ref pointer to an nsCOMPtr.

This commit is contained in:
tbogard%aol.net 1999-11-12 09:13:52 +00:00
Родитель 98a1f3c523
Коммит 478cebc8b7
1 изменённых файлов: 51 добавлений и 52 удалений

Просмотреть файл

@ -203,10 +203,9 @@ nsDocShell::SetDocument(nsIDOMDocument *aDOMDoc, nsIDOMElement *aRootNode)
NS_ENSURE_SUCCESS(NS_OpenURI(getter_AddRefs(dummyChannel), uri, nsnull), NS_ERROR_FAILURE);
// (4) fire start document load notification
nsIStreamListener* outStreamListener=nsnull; // a valid pointer is required for the returned stream listener
NS_ENSURE_SUCCESS(doc->StartDocumentLoad("view", dummyChannel, nsnull, this, &outStreamListener),
NS_ERROR_FAILURE);
NS_IF_RELEASE(outStreamListener);
nsCOMPtr<nsIStreamListener> outStreamListener;
NS_ENSURE_SUCCESS(doc->StartDocumentLoad("view", dummyChannel, nsnull, this,
getter_AddRefs(outStreamListener)), NS_ERROR_FAILURE);
NS_ENSURE_SUCCESS(FireStartDocumentLoad(mDocLoader, uri, "load"), NS_ERROR_FAILURE);
// (5) hook up the document and its content
@ -577,7 +576,7 @@ NS_IMETHODIMP nsDocShell::CutSelection()
//XXX Implement
//XXXIMPL
//Should check to find the current focused object. Then cut the contents.
return NS_ERROR_FAILURE;
}